This is an early pocket guide to conjuring written by the society conjurer Frank Desmond and published in 1897. Part of the Saxon's Everybody Series, it describes how to perform a wide range of magic tricks with early illustrations, many of which have been reproduced from Hamley's blocks. A charming and uncommon little book.
